Prenatal Finding of Clinodactyly: Clinical Implications

When clinodactyly is identified on prenatal ultrasound, it should prompt careful evaluation for associated anomalies and consideration of genetic syndromes, though isolated clinodactyly is typically a benign finding that rarely requires intervention.

Primary Clinical Significance

Clinodactyly as an isolated finding is generally a minor anatomical variant with minimal clinical consequence. However, its presence warrants systematic evaluation because it can be associated with:

  • Chromosomal abnormalities, particularly trisomy 21 (Down syndrome), when found in combination with other soft markers 1
  • Genetic syndromes including complex chromosomal rearrangements involving deletions and duplications 2
  • Multiple congenital anomaly syndromes where clinodactyly may be one component of a broader phenotype 3

Recommended Evaluation Algorithm

Immediate Assessment Steps

Perform a comprehensive anatomical survey to determine if clinodactyly is truly isolated or part of a constellation of findings 3. Specifically evaluate for:

  • Cardiac anomalies, particularly atrioventricular septal defects 2
  • Central nervous system abnormalities including ventriculomegaly 2
  • Skeletal abnormalities such as short long bones, abnormal chest configuration, or other limb deformities 1, 2
  • Facial dysmorphism including flat nasal bridge or absent/hypoplastic nasal bone 1, 2
  • Other soft markers of aneuploidy 1

Aneuploidy Risk Assessment

The approach to further testing depends critically on prior screening results:

  • If no prior aneuploidy screening has been performed: Offer cell-free DNA testing or quad screen, with discussion of diagnostic amniocentesis based on patient preference and clinical context 1
  • If prior screening was negative: The residual risk remains low, and isolated clinodactyly does not substantially alter management 1
  • If multiple anomalies are present: Strongly consider diagnostic testing via amniocentesis with chromosomal microarray analysis 3

Advanced Imaging Considerations

When clinodactyly is associated with other structural findings, additional imaging modalities may clarify the diagnosis 3:

  • Fetal echocardiography if cardiac defects are suspected 3
  • 3D ultrasound to better characterize limb and skeletal abnormalities 1
  • Fetal MRI for evaluation of central nervous system or complex anatomical questions 1, 3

Genetic Counseling and Testing

Referral to genetic counseling is appropriate when clinodactyly is part of multiple anomalies or when there is concern for an underlying syndrome 3. Consider:

  • Parental examination and imaging to assess for dominantly inherited conditions 3
  • Retention of fetal DNA for future testing if diagnosis remains unclear 1
  • Next-generation sequencing panels or whole exome sequencing when skeletal dysplasia or complex syndrome is suspected 4

Prognostic Implications

Isolated Clinodactyly

When truly isolated after thorough evaluation, clinodactyly has excellent prognosis:

  • Functional limitation is rare, typically only occurring with angulation >25 degrees 5
  • Most cases require no treatment and are managed expectantly 5, 6
  • Surgical correction is reserved for cases with significant functional impairment, typically performed in childhood if needed 5, 7

Clinodactyly with Associated Anomalies

The prognosis depends entirely on the associated findings rather than the clinodactyly itself 2, 3. When part of:

  • Chromosomal abnormalities: Prognosis relates to the specific aneuploidy or chromosomal rearrangement 2
  • Skeletal dysplasia: Requires evaluation for lethality predictors including chest-to-abdomen ratio <0.6, femur length to abdominal circumference ratio <0.16, and severe micromelia 1, 8
  • Syndromic presentations: Outcomes vary based on the specific syndrome and organ systems involved 3

Postnatal Management Planning

All fetuses with prenatally identified clinodactyly, whether isolated or associated with other findings, should undergo comprehensive postnatal evaluation 1, 3:

  • Complete physical examination by a pediatrician or geneticist to confirm prenatal findings and identify additional features 3
  • Skeletal radiographic survey if skeletal dysplasia was suspected prenatally 1, 4
  • Pediatric subspecialty consultation as indicated by associated anomalies (cardiology, neurology, orthopedics) 3
  • Genetic testing confirmation if chromosomal abnormality or syndrome was suspected 3

Critical Pitfalls to Avoid

Do not dismiss clinodactyly without thorough evaluation for associated anomalies, as it may be the first clue to a significant underlying condition 2, 3. Common errors include:

  • Failing to perform detailed anatomical survey when any structural anomaly is identified 3
  • Not offering appropriate genetic counseling when multiple anomalies are present 3
  • Inadequate postnatal follow-up even when prenatal diagnosis seems clear 1
  • Confusing clinodactyly with camptodactyly, which are distinct entities requiring different approaches 6

In cases of pregnancy termination or neonatal death, strongly encourage complete autopsy by a perinatal pathologist, or at minimum external examination with photographs and radiographs, as this provides essential information for diagnosis, prognosis, and recurrence risk counseling 1, 3.
